Advanced Signal Processing : Theory and Implementation for Sonar, Radar, and Non-Invasive Medical Diagnostic Systems, Second Edition
Other Available Formats
Overview
Continuing in the bestselling tradition of the first edition, this book integrates topics of signal processing from sonar, radar, and medical system technologies by identifying their concept similarities. The second edition continues to gather the most pertinent information in advanced signal processing and provides substantial updates to the section on non-invasive medical diagnostic system applications, including intracranial ultrasound, an emerging technology that attempts to address non-invasive detection on brain injuries and stroke. The chapter titled Adapting Systems in Signal Processing represents a coherent summary of Simon Haykin's work in the relevant field.
